A scalene triangle has three unequal sides and three unequal angles. This type of triangle is less common in design and architecture but can be used to create unique and asymmetrical compositions.
An equilateral triangle has three equal sides and three equal angles. This type of triangle is commonly used in design and architecture for its stability, symmetry, and beauty. Equilateral triangles can be found in nature, such as in the structure of honeycombs, and are also used in graphic design, engineering, and interior design.
A right-angled triangle has one 90-degree angle and two acute angles. This type of triangle is essential in trigonometry and is used to calculate distances, heights, and other measurements. Right-angled triangles are also used in architecture to create balanced and harmonious compositions.

Types of Triangles
A triangle is a fundamental shape in geometry, consisting of three sides and three angles. There are various types of triangles, including equilateral, isosceles, scalene, right-angled, obtuse, and acute triangles. Each type has distinct characteristics, such as side lengths, angle measures, and properties. Understanding the properties and relationships of these triangles is essential for creating functional and visually appealing structures.

Triangles have been used in various art forms, including painting, sculpture, and graphic design. They add visual interest, create balance, and evoke emotions. Artists and designers use triangles to create complex compositions, experiment with geometry, and push creative boundaries.
